    TimewARP 2600 Getting Started Guide Synth Glossary Voltage-Controlled Oscillator (VCO) - simple sound wave generator. Voltage-Controlled Filter (VCF) - a tone-shaping control. A typical EQ is really just a set of filters grouped together. Filter Cutoff (FC) - the point at which a filter begins to reject frequencies. For instance, a low-pass filter will cut highs out of a signal beginning at a certain point, only passing the low frequencies on.

    With the initial gain control at maximum, and with no control input, the VCA will pass with unchanged amplitude ❶ any signal presented to its signal input. On the other hand, with the initial gain control at minimum, no signal will pass through the amplifier at all unless some positive signal level (the VCA does not respond to negative control signals) is present at one or both of its control inputs.

    TimewARP 2600 Getting Started Guide Ring Modulator The Ring Modulator ❶ adds or subtracts the inputs from VCO1 and VCO2 together. It works with a carrier signal and a modulator. The term “Ring Modulator” is the most common name in sound synthesis and comes from the original analog method for creating this effect: a ring with four paired diodes accompanied by precision transformers.

    Sample and Hold The Sample and Hold module produces stepped output signals by sampling the instantaneous value of any signal at its input. The stepped levels it produces are useful for controlling oscillator and filter frequencies and occasionally VCA gain. Any signal whatsoever may be sampled. The default input is from the Noise Generator , so that the step sequence is random.
